Description Christopher Cowart 2006-02-28 01:49:51 UTC
I've successfully built a toolchain using crossdev for mipsel-linksys-linux-uclibc. I'm using current gcc, binutils, uclibc-0.9.27-r1, mips-headers-2.4.28-r1. 

Now, whenever I emerge -pvuDN world, I get:
[blocks B     ] cross-mipsel-linksys-linux-uclibc/mips-headers (is blocking sys-kernel/linux-headers-2.6.11-r2)

I'm guessing portage doesn't like two packages providing virtual/os-headers. Let me know if I can provide any more useful information.
